ancillary - WordReference. com Dictionary of English an•cil•lar•y (an′ sə ler′ē or, esp Brit , an sil′ ə rē), adj , n , pl -lar•ies adj subordinate; subsidiary auxiliary; assisting n something that serves in an ancillary capacity: Slides, records, and other ancillaries can be used with the basic textbook
Ancillary - definition of ancillary by The Free Dictionary Auxiliary or accessory: an ancillary pump 1 Something that is subordinate or accessory to something else: a tripod, battery charger, and other camera ancillaries 2 A person working in a supportive or subordinate role: school ancillaries who look after children who become sick
